Fort Laramie has about 230 residents and an elevation of 4,239 feet Fort Laramie (/ ˈ l ær ə m i /; founded as Fort William and known for a while as Fort John) was a significant 19th-century trading post, diplomatic site, and military installation located at the confluence of the Laramie and the North Platte Rivers.They joined in the upper Platte River Valley in the eastern part of the present-day US state of Wyoming.The fort was founded as a private.
